在控制器中选择单选按钮的过程可以通过以下步骤完成:
以下是一个示例代码:
在控制器中:
app.controller('MyController', function($scope) {
$scope.selectedOption = ''; // 定义一个变量来存储选择结果
// 处理选择结果的逻辑
$scope.handleSelection = function() {
if ($scope.selectedOption === 'option1') {
// 执行某些操作
} else if ($scope.selectedOption === 'option2') {
// 执行其他操作
} else {
// 处理其他情况
}
};
});
在视图中:
<div ng-controller="MyController">
<label>
<input type="radio" ng-model="selectedOption" value="option1"> 选项1
</label>
<label>
<input type="radio" ng-model="selectedOption" value="option2"> 选项2
</label>
<label>
<input type="radio" ng-model="selectedOption" value="option3"> 选项3
</label>
<button ng-click="handleSelection()">处理选择结果</button>
</div>
在这个示例中,我们使用ng-model指令将单选按钮的值与控制器中的selectedOption变量进行绑定。当用户选择一个选项时,selectedOption变量将被更新为相应的值。在控制器中,我们定义了handleSelection函数来处理选择结果。根据selectedOption的值,我们可以执行不同的操作。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云